Popular Welding Certifications

Despite the fact that the AWS’ normal CW (Certified Welder) card helps make you eligible for almost all positions, a number of industries demand their specialized certification. Some of the most-common of which are highlighted below.

  • CWI and SCWI Certificates for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ors
  • API Certification for welders who work with pipelines in the energy field
  • Certified Welder Certification to become a Certified Welder
  • ASME Certification for welders who work with boiler and pressure vessels

This table illustrates employment and salary projections for professional welders in Utah through the end of the decade.

Utah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 4,480 5,500 23% 210
Utah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$24,900 $35,900 $56,900

Source: O*Net Online

The Fundamentals of Welding Programs

Even though there is not a guide on the ways to pick the best certified welding schools, there are certain items to consider. Once you get started looking around, you will find tons of classes, but just what should you really try to look for when deciding on welding specialist programs? The training schools that you’re planning to enter should be accepted by a national oversight organization such as the AWS . Just after looking into the accreditation status, you should also explore a little bit deeper to be certain that the school you want can provide you with the appropriate instruction.

  • Be certain the college teaches on gear that fits field specifications
  • See if the school provides financial assistance
  • Make certain the college’s curriculum offers classes in GTAW, SMAW, pipe welding and GMAW
  • Look for schools that comply with AWS SENSE standards
